2019级C课程设计题目

发布 2020-02-26 19:05:28 阅读 2178

总体需求

编写一个图书管理程序。

图书信息的组成部分为:图书名称、国家、类型、借阅标记等。

出租信息的组成部分为:会员名、图书名称、借阅日期、归还日期、租金等。

功能需求 1) 新书购入:添加图书信息。

2) 图书查询:按书名查询某书是否可借阅,结果有三种(可借阅、已借出、无此书)。

3) 图书借阅:输入会员名、图书名称、借阅日期,修改图书的租借标记(每个会员一次可借阅多书)

4)图书归还:输入会员名、图书名称、归还日期,修改图书的租借标记,计算每书租金(每三天的租金为1元,不满三天的按三天计算)。因为每个会员一次可借阅多书,所以也可能一次归还多书。

在该操作结束前,应输出该会员此次归还所需支付的总租金。

5)用子函数实现各个子功能。

用户界面。输入: 程序正常运行后,屏幕上显示一个文字菜单(根据序号选定相应的操作项目),当用户选定操作项目所对应的序号时,根据应用程序的提示信息,从键盘上输入相应的数据。

输出: 1) 应用程序正常运行后,要在屏幕上显示一个文字菜单。

2) 要求用户输入数据时,要给出清晰、明确的提示信息,包括输入的数据内容、格式及结束方式等。

提示与参考。

1)为各项操作功能设计一个菜单,应用程序运行后,先显示这个菜单,然后用户通过菜单项选择希望进行的操作项目。

2) 图书信息可定义为一个结构体;关键在于考虑出租信息的表示,这将决定实现借阅和归还操作的算法。采用文件保存数据。

功能要求:1)试设计一个职工信息管理系统,使之能提供以下功能:

2)系统以菜单方式工作。

3)职工信息录入功能(职工信息用文件保存)——输入。

4)职工信息浏览功能——输出。

5)查询或排序功能:(至少一种查询方式)——算法,按工资查询,按学历查询等。

6)系统进入画面(静态或动画)

7)职工信息删除功能。

8)职工信息修改功能。

信息描述。职工信息包括职工号、姓名、性别、出生年月、学历、职务、工资、住址、**等(职工号不重复)。

功能描述。1. 录入职工信息并保存。

2. 显示所有职工信息(以一定的格式)

3. 查询职工信息(以一种或多种方式)

4. 修改职工信息并保存。

5. 删除职工信息。

学生信息包括:学号,姓名,班级,年龄,性别,出生年月,地址,**以及学生选课情况(包括本学期的课程)

功能要求:系统以菜单方式工作(用键盘输入1~6之间的数字来选择功能)

1、 学生信息录入功能(以文件方式保存)

2、 学生信息浏览功能。

3、 学生信息查询功能(可以按学号,班级,性别分别进行查询,用子菜单,可显示多条记录)

4、 学生信息删除功能(按学号进行删除)

5、 学生信息修改功能(按学号修改)

6、 不及格学生成绩汇总功能。

该系统是帮助学生背诵单词的软件,要求学生可以编辑自己的词库,系统可以给出中文,让学生输入英文意思,以可以输入英文让学生输入中文意思,并判定词义是否正确,如不正确给出提树,要求用户重新输入。如果正确给以鼓励。词库用文件存储。

基本功能:1、 词库的维护(可增加,删除,修改,至少要100个单词)

2、 输入中文,显示英文结果。

3、 输入英文,显示中文结果。

4、 背诵成绩的记录。

C 课程设计题目 2019

c 题目一 职工信息管理系统 限1人完成 1 问题描述 功能要求 职工信息包括职工号 姓名 性别 年龄 学历 工资 住址 等 职工号不重复 试设计一职工信息管理系统,使之能提供以下功能 1 系统以菜单方式工作。2 职工信息录入功能 职工信息用文件保存 输入。3 职工信息浏览功能 输出。4 查询和排序...

C 课程设计题目

课程设计。一 题目 在下列题目中,任选一题 1.掷骰子游戏设计。2.用c 语言设计求解线性规划的单纯形法3 采用面象对象技术实现一个货币系统4.制作一个电子课程表。5.实现一个电梯实时状况模拟程序6.学生成绩管理系统7.图书管理系统。二 文档要求。1 需求分析 要求实现的功能和实现方式 2 系统总框...

C课程设计题目

面向对象的程序设计 c 课程设计题目。姚远2011 12 16 使用专业 班级 计科10 信管10 计网 计应 软件10级。说明 以下各题的实现技术不包括任何数据库访问技术,如等。部分题目需要通过各种集合类完成数据在内存中的存储 集中管理。每题采用分层架构模式来完成。均需自行设计类,windows窗...